Name: | Carn Dubh |
Hill number: | 3104 |
Height: | 822m / 2697ft |
Parent (Ma): | 461 Glas Maol |
RHB Section: | 07A: Braemar to Montrose |
County/UA: | Aberdeenshire |
Catchment: | Dee (Aberdeen) |
Class: | Simm, Corbett Top (Tu,Sim,CT) |
Grid ref: | NO 16186 81943 |
Summit feature: | cairn |
Drop: | 72m |
Col: | 750m NO167814 |
OS map sheet(s): | (1:50k) 43 (1:25k) OL52N 387N |
Observations: | knoll 200m to SW at NO 16055 81796 is marginally lower |
Survey: | Abney level |

An ATV track from the Old Shielings about half a km along the path from the A93 car park leads steadily up between the main summit and its South Top, allowing a quick bag of the latter and a sweat avoiding walk up to the former. Hags and heather most of the way, but summit plateau is short and soft underfoot. | summitter | 02/08/2020 |

Solo. From car parking area at NO147800 up path towards Carn an Tuirc. Near burn junction at N0158803 struck up hillside over short heather, grass and moss to reach summit of Carn Dubh. Cairn and knoll SW do appear to be of similar height. There is another cairn roughly SE from summit cairn, but this is lower. Continued to Carn an Tuirc, Cairn of Claise and Sròn na Gaoithe. | pwbellarby | 14/10/2015 |
